Native Nitrogen-Fixing Plants
Various species (Fabaceae family and others)
shrubNitrogen-fixing native plants are species adapted to local regions that form symbiotic relationships with nitrogen-fixing bacteria in their root nodules, enriching soil naturally. These plants reduce or eliminate the need for synthetic nitrogen fertilizers while providing ecological benefits. Common families include legumes (Fabaceae), which are the primary nitrogen-fixers, along with some non-legume species.

Germination & Seedling
1-3 weeksSeeds sprout and develop first true leaves. Root system begins developing with cotyledons emerging.
Keep soil consistently moist but not waterlogged. Provide bright light. Inoculate seeds with appropriate Rhizobium bacteria for optimal nitrogen fixation.
Establishment & Root Development
3-8 weeksYoung plants grow taller with expanding leaf canopy. Root nodules begin forming where nitrogen-fixing bacteria colonize.
Maintain moderate moisture. Avoid high-nitrogen fertilizers which inhibit nodule formation. Thin seedlings if necessary.
Vegetative Growth
4-12 weeks (varies by species)Vigorous growth with multiple stems/branches and full foliage. Plant reaches mature size with active nitrogen fixation occurring.
Water during drought. Prune if needed for shape. Monitor for pests. Nitrogen-fixing nodules are now fully active.
Flowering & Reproduction
4-8 weeksPlant produces characteristic flowers (often showy legume flowers, pea-like blooms). Attracts pollinators.
Continue regular watering. Avoid disturbing root zone. Allow flowers to develop naturally for seed production.
Seed Production & Maturity
6-12 weeksFlowers develop into seed pods. Plant reaches full maturity with established, nitrogen-fixing root system.
Allow pods to dry on plant before harvest if collecting seeds. Plant continues nitrogen fixation throughout mature life.

Uses
Soil Enrichment & Green Manure
HouseholdNitrogen-fixing plants naturally replenish soil nitrogen through symbiotic bacteria in root nodules, reducing fertilizer needs and improving soil health for future crops. Cut plants and incorporate into soil for sustainable land management. [source]
Wildlife Habitat & Pollinator Support
WildlifeNative nitrogen-fixing plants provide nectar, pollen, and seeds for native bees, butterflies, and other pollinators while supporting broader ecosystem health. They are essential components of native plant communities. [source]
Food Crops (Species-Dependent)
CulinarySome nitrogen-fixing natives produce edible seeds, legumes, or pods (e.g., local bean species). Check species-specific uses in your region. [source]
Traditional Medicine (Species-Dependent)
MedicinalVarious native nitrogen-fixing plants have traditional medicinal uses in their native regions, though applications vary widely by species and culture. [source]
Erosion Control & Stabilization
CraftDeep root systems help stabilize soil on slopes and prevent erosion while building soil structure and nitrogen content over time. [source]

Harvest Tips
Harvest seeds when pods are dry and brown but before they shatter naturally. Collect in late summer/fall. Cut plants for erosion control and soil enrichment, or leave standing for wildlife. Can be used as green manure by cutting and turning into soil.
Fun Facts
- 🌱 Nitrogen-fixing plants form a remarkable symbiotic relationship with Rhizobium bacteria: the plant provides carbohydrates to the bacteria, which convert atmospheric nitrogen into usable ammonia for the plant—a natural fertilizer factory.
- 🌱 Native nitrogen-fixers can reduce commercial fertilizer needs by 50-100%, making them economically valuable for sustainable agriculture and landscaping.
- 🌱 Different native nitrogen-fixing species require different bacterial inoculants; using native plant seeds inoculated with locally-adapted Rhizobium strains maximizes effectiveness.
